Abstract
(Englisch)
The aim of this study is to find an optical solution to recover in real time the 6 degrees of freedom of the spatial position of a wireless pen for new generations of 3-D tablet PCs. The 6-DOF position of the pen must be detected in a large working volume of 40 x 40 x 40 cm3 with a very high precision of 100 ¿Ým in real time. The latency of high precision detection must be less than 5 ms combined with one year autonomy on a single AAA battery and low cost of 5 US$.
